IBM ILOG Scheduler User's Manual > Getting Started with Scheduler > Using Reservoirs > Describe the Problem--Example 9

In this example we again have four workers who are required to build five houses. These workers are specialized just like those in Example 6.

The five houses have the three designs, and the corresponding activity durations, shown in Table 5.1 in Adding Transition Times. However, in this problem, each activity costs $1,000 per day. Each activity also produces a profit of $1,000 when it is completed.

Once again, our objective is to minimize the makespan of the problem.
